Double wall underground conduit, made in polyethylene, ideal for installation and protection of cables and electrical conduits in buildings and housing. Conduits protect against mechanical and chemical influences, moisture, heat and cold, abrasion, impact, and pressure – countless applications, not least including robotics, telecommunication, renewable energies, and mechanical engineering. IK10 Maximum Standard Rating (20 J) Withstands a 5 kg hammer dropped 400mm, suitable for exposed.

Low voltage wiring typically involves circuits operating at 50 volts or less, commonly found in home systems like thermostats, doorbells, security devices, and outdoor landscape lighting.
